1. Product Overview
The Baby Einstein Magic Touch Ukulele is a wooden musical toy designed to introduce young children to music. It features two play modes: Freestyle and Play Along, allowing children to explore musical creativity and rhythm. The toy produces realistic chord sounds and includes volume control for user convenience.

3. Setup
Battery Installation:
The Magic Touch Ukulele requires 3 AA batteries (not included).
- Locate the battery compartment on the back of the ukulele.
- Using a screwdriver, open the battery compartment cover.
- Insert 3 AA batteries, ensuring correct polarity (+/-).
- Replace the battery compartment cover and secure it with the screw.

4. Operating Instructions
Power On/Off:
Locate the power switch on the control panel. Slide the switch to the 'ON' position to activate the toy. Slide to 'OFF' to power down.
Volume Control:
The control panel includes buttons for adjusting the volume. Press the '+' button to increase volume and '-' button to decrease volume. There are multiple volume levels, including a silent mode where the toy can still be used for tactile play without sound.
Play Modes:
The ukulele offers two distinct play modes, selectable via a switch on the control panel:
- Freestyle Mode: In this mode, touching the strings or the touch-sensitive area will produce individual chord sounds, allowing for creative and spontaneous musical exploration.
- Play Along Mode: When this mode is selected, touching the strings or the touch-sensitive area will trigger pre-recorded melodies, and the child's touch will interact with the tune.
Press the central Baby Einstein button to switch between different melodies or sound effects within the selected mode.

5. Maintenance
Cleaning:
- Wipe the toy with a soft, damp cloth.
- Do not immerse the toy in water.
-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
Storage:
- Store the toy in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ight.
- Remove batteries if the toy will not be used for an extended period to prevent leakage.
